Join local tour guide Joe Pritchard Saturday December 12st at 2:00 p.m. for a PowerPoint presentation of “Christmas in Seattle from 1851 to now.” Joe will talk about “what to do in Seattle” from Christmas to New Year’s Day. Around 3:00 p.m., he will give a walking and (free) city bus tour of the tallest indoor Christmas tree, home of the Teddy Bear Suite, Ginger Bread House displays, and Christmas train display at Macy’s. Admission is free and the public is invited.
Later that evening at 7:00 p.m. the Metro Employee Historic Vehicle Association will drive a historic bus for a three hour tour of Seattle's best Christmas lights. That tour costs $5.00 and will leave from the 2nd Ave and Main Street. For details go to www.mehva.org.
